Abstract

The present application belongs to the technical field of transport aircraft performance design, and in particular relates to a design method and system for transport aircraft to take off at a high-clearance airport with overweight. If not, the transport aircraft takes off normally. Under the premise of determining that an overweight takeoff is necessary, a judgment is made as to whether there is a one-engine failure between the various parameters in the overweight takeoff control speed. Combined with the current takeoff scenario conditions, an accurate and quantitative judgment is made on whether an overweight takeoff is possible, thereby realizing a stable, long-term, and large-scale air transport judgment process. It can also accurately judge whether a transport aircraft can take off under the condition of one-engine failure, and has a wide range of applications.
